Bilateral Periorbital Hematoma is simply a black eye or a shiner. The so-called black eye is caused by bleeding beneath the skin and around the eye.

An eye drop can help ease irritation in the eye after swimming in the sea by rinsing out any saltwater or debris that may be causing the irritation. It can also provide lubrication to relieve dryness and discomfort in the eye. Additionally, some eye drops may have ingredients that help reduce inflammation and redness.

The recommended pH for a swimming pool is around 7.2 to 7.8pH. Anything higher than 8.0. * It can lead to Eye Irritation and Skin Irritation Anything Lower than 7.0 * It can lead to Eye Irritation and Skin Irritation and in the pool itself it can cause pipe erosion.
Conjunctivitis is an irritation and redness of the membrane covering the eye. It is also known as pink eye and can be caused by infections, allergies, or irritants. Symptoms can include redness, itching, discharge, and tearing.
Nicotine in the eye can cause irritation, redness, tearing, and a burning sensation. It is important to flush the eye with clean water for several minutes and seek medical attention if irritation persists.
